  1. This is a list of intelligence agencies by country. It includes only currently operational institutions. An intelligence agency is a government agency responsible for the collection, analysis, and exploitation of information in support of law enforcement, national security, military, and foreign policy objectives.   5. In the Federal Republic of Germany, 17 agencies deal with domestic intelligence matters. This is a challenge for how this mission as such is organised and at times raises numerous questions on how cooperation works in practice: How can the services guarantee that collected information is shared with one another?
